Handover note — Crumbwheel order cutoffs.

Welcome aboard. The bakery cutoff rule in Crumbwheel closes same-day orders at 14:00 local to each storefront, not UTC — this has bitten us twice. Holiday overrides live in the calendar service and take precedence silently, so always check there first when a cutoff looks wrong. To unlock the calendar service's admin console after a restart, enter the recovery passphrase below.

vault phrase of bagap-bahaf = silion-pelox-sorox-casdor-quenwyn-fraax-eliox-praael-kelion-quenvan-kasox-rusael-norius-belvan

Sales leads should plan around the confirmed closure of the Hartsmere office at the end of next quarter. Territory coverage for the northern accounts will shift to the Calderwick team, with account handovers completed no later than week eight. Travel budgets will be adjusted to reflect increased on-site visits during the transition, and pipeline reviews will move to a fortnightly cadence until coverage stabilises. Please flag any at-risk renewals in the Hartsmere book immediately. The strategic reasoning is summarised confidentially below.

management briefing: Project Ulavan slips by two quarters because of the staffing delay.

### Greenhouse controller sync — excerpt

Humidity sensors in the Fernhollow units are drifting roughly 2% per month, likely condensation on the probe housing. Controller firmware 4.2 adds weekly auto-recalibration; until rollout, support should advise manual recalibration at each site visit and log readings before and after. Drift escalations go to the engineer named below.

named custodian: Belius Casath Ulaix Sorius

# Shrinkpile CLI — Session Handling

The `shrinkpile` batch resizer keeps a session per invocation. Sessions expire after 30 minutes idle; re-auth is automatic if a refresh credential exists in `~/.shrinkpile/session`. Don't commit that file. For contractor onboarding, use the sandbox tenant only. Resize jobs over 500 images require a session with the `bulk` scope. The sandbox bearer token for initial setup is below.

portal login ticket: eyJhbGciOiJIUzI1NiIsInR5cCI6IkpXVCJ9.eyJzdWIiOiIMjvRAf3PEFIn0.nuv9gjixLtnr